Home > DMT_EditorControl > generateIndicatorMarkers
DMT_EditorControl.generateIndicatorMarkers() method
This API is provided as a beta preview for developers and may change based on feedback that we receive. Do not use this API in a production environment.
生成指示标记
Signature
typescript
generateIndicatorMarkers(markers: Array<IDMT_IndicatorMarkerShape>, color?: {
r: number;
g: number;
b: number;
alpha: number;
}, tabId?: string): Promise<boolean>;
1
2
3
4
5
6
2
3
4
5
6
Parameters
Parameter | Type | Description |
---|---|---|
markers | Array<IDMT_IndicatorMarkerShape> | 指示标记外形对象数组 |
color | { r: number; g: number; b: number; alpha: number; } | (Optional) 指示标记颜色 |
tabId | string | (Optional) 标签页 ID,如若未传入,则为最后输入焦点的画布 |
Returns
Promise<boolean>
指示标记生成是否成功,false
表示画布不支持该操作或 tabId
不存在
Remarks
指示标记外形数据中,原理图、符号画布坐标单位跨度为 0.01inch,PCB、封装画布坐标单位跨度为 mil